Windows 10's built-in antivirus can now be used to download viruses A recent update to the built-in antivirus software in Windows 10 has taught the program a new trick—how to download files through a command line tool, including nefarious ones (trojans, spyware, ransomware, and other malware). Downloading malware is not the intended purpose, at least I presume that's not the case. Windows 10 built-in antivirus - Microsoft Community Much like Windows 8, Windows 10 will include "Windows Defender", which is virtually identical to the "Microsoft Security Essentials" package available for Windows 7. This anti-virus software should protect against most viruses. This anti-virus software will come included with Windows 10 and no further installation should be required. Stay protected with Windows Security - support.microsoft.com Windows Security is built-in to Windows and includes an antivirus program called Microsoft Defender Antivirus. (In early versions of Windows 10, Windows Security is called Windows Defender Security Center). If you have another antivirus app installed and turned on, Microsoft Defender Antivirus will turn off automatically.
